The dinosaur of the day: Ruyangosaurus

  • Titanosauriform sauropod that lived within the Early Cretaceous in what’s now Henan, China (Haoling Formation)
  • Very massive sauropod, so had an extended neck, an extended tail, and walked on all fours
  • Had a small head
  • Most likely had a large physique
  • Estimated by Gregory Paul to be about 98 ft (30 m) lengthy and weigh 55 tons (over 50 metric tonnes)
  • One other estimate was it was 115 ft (35 m lengthy), primarily based on the femur (thigh bone)
  • A 2020 estimate was over 81 ft (nearly 25 m) lengthy and weighing 37.5 tons (34 metric tonnes)
  • One paper in 2017 confirmed skeletal and life restorations, with hypothesized osteoderms (spikes) on the top of the again and starting of the tail, and appears like a really large dinosaur
  • Kind species is Ruyangosaurus giganteus
  • Described in 2009 by Junchang Lü and others
  • Genus title means “Ruyang County lizard”
  • Genus title refers to Ruyang County of Henan Province
  • Species title means massive in Greek, and refers to it being “an enormous sauropod dinosaur”
  • Based on the paper that named the dinosaur: “The brand new sauropod clearly represents a brand new and gigantic dinosaur […] and represents the most important dinosaur discovered from Asia to date”
  • One of many largest dinosaurs of the japanese hemisphere
  • Holotype features a couple vertebrae, a pair ribs, a part of the best thigh bone, and a whole proper decrease leg bone (tibia)
  • Two skeletons identified
  • Consists of neck bones, again bones, a part of the hips, tail bones, ribs, a whole proper humerus (arm bone), a whole proper femur (thigh bone), and a whole proper tibia (decrease leg bone)
  • There’s a big sauropod, Huanghetitan that was discovered close by, however the again vertebrae look totally different (Ruyangosaurus is far bigger)
  • Extra sturdy than Huanghetitan
  • Exhausting to match with Huanghetitan, as a result of totally different bones have been discovered of every (can’t examine apples to apples), however the centrum of the again vertebra (center half) is far bigger, so would imply Ruyangosaurus was bigger
  • Had an extended, slender femur and brief, sturdy tibia
  • Is analogous to Argentinosaurus (width of the again vertebra)
  • Had shorter neural spines than Argentinosaurus
  • Had a decrease neural backbone, a strong tibia that was 50 in or 127 cm lengthy, and particulars within the arches
  • Helps present there have been was extra range in sauropods within the Early Cretaceous in what’s now Asia, and probably that point interval was key for the evolution and variety of enormous titanosauriforms
  • Different dinosaurs that lived across the similar time and place embrace the sauropods Xianshanosaurus, Huanghetitan, and Yunmenglong, the ankylosaur Zhongyuansaurus, the oviraptorid Luoyanggia, in addition to ornithomimids, iguanodonts, and carcharodontosaurids
  • On the time, world temperatures have been usually heat, and there have been in all probability seasons, which can have helped angiosperms unfold out, which can have helped titanosauriforms
